Head-to-Head History
The historical rivalry between Hertha BSC II and BSG Chemie Leipzig has been consistently competitive, with BSG Chemie Leipzig holding a slight edge in recent encounters. In the last 11 meetings, BSG Chemie Leipzig has secured six victories compared to three for Hertha BSC II, with two matches ending in draws. The average goal count per game stands at 3.27, highlighting a pattern of high-scoring contests. Additionally, 64% of these fixtures have featured both teams scoring, indicating that attacking play is often a key feature of their matchups.
Recent results show that BSG Chemie Leipzig has been particularly effective against Hertha BSC II, especially in home games. Their most recent win on 25 October 2025 came with a 3-1 victory, while they also claimed a 2-2 draw earlier in the season. Despite this, Hertha BSC II has managed to secure some notable results, such as a 3-0 win over BSG Chemie Leipzig in July 2023. These performances suggest that while BSG Chemie Leipzig has dominated overall, Hertha BSC II can pose a threat if they maintain strong defensive organization and capitalize on counterattacks.
